Role Responsibilities
* Carry out property inspections and stock condition surveys.
* Support planned maintenance, repair works and capital investment projects.
* Ensure properties meet building safety and regulatory standards.
* Conduct pre- and post-inspections of void properties.
* Liaise with contractors to ensure work is delivered to a high standard.
* Contribute to asset performance reviews and technical reporting.
* Work collaboratively with housing, repairs and compliance teams.
* Support sustainability and energy-efficiency initiatives.
* Engage with vulnerable residents and partner organisations within supported housing.
Requirements
* Previous experience in a surveying role, or an experienced multi-trades professional.
* A full, valid UK driving licence with no more than six penalty points.
* Strong verbal and written communication skills.
* Two professional references will be required.
